Output 2607edc19a76b4e4080b574f03e3d19ada5503e53e259b7eba31f66ce1a961f7:83

value
11551601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15d93c967c7fe4569af16138a6b8b81921273e1d OP_EQUALVERIFY OP_CHECKSIG
address
12zXRu2Qa7WcEkdQf1qZHrxpqMPRTCNpLY
transaction
2607edc19a76b4e4080b574f03e3d19ada5503e53e259b7eba31f66ce1a961f7
confirmations
513316
spent
true